(qi3)

The character 屺 (qǐ) refers to a grassy or barren knoll, often depicting a small elevation in the landscape. It can also symbolize a mountain that lacks vegetation, giving it a distinct appearance. This term is less commonly used in modern language but may appear in literary contexts or discussions about geography.

Common Mistakes

Learners often confuse 屺 with similar characters like 山 (shān) due to their related meanings about mountains and hills. Ensure to distinguish between them based on context, as 屺 specifically refers to a knoll without vegetation.
